OK, so now I am getting a few bits sorted on my MK, I am now looking towards changing the steering rack for a quicker steer jobby. At the moment it has about 4 turns lock to lock, which I guess is the standard Rack.

What I would like is more like 2.5 - 2.9, but am more concerned about the process of changing. What I really would like is for a new rack which simply replaces the current one, mark the track rod positions and swap them over. Am I being too hopeful ? Does a rack exist that will allow this ?

Too hopeful.
The MK rack is shortened from the off the shelf size, so this would need doing.
As far as marking and putting back together with no adjustment needed, no chance!
